§ 143:21 — Forbidden Harvesting

Text
No shellfish shall be harvested in New Hampshire for food unless taken from areas approved by the commissioner of the department of environmental services. If taken from out-of-state sources, shellfish harvested for food shall be taken from areas approved by the appropriate state regulatory shellfish authorities having jurisdiction, and secured from shellfish dealers currently listed on the United States Public Health Service publication of approved shellfish shippers.
